Job Description

We’re hiring a Federal Account Executive to lead our Public Sector defense industrial base (DIB) business — focusing on defense primes, key integrators, and contractors building and operating mission‑critical systems for U.S. Federal agencies. This is a strategic, full‑cycle enterprise sales role. You will own a focused set of high‑value accounts, build the DIB/federal‑adjacent motion, and close complex, multi‑stakeholder SaaS and AI deals. Glean is actively working toward FedRAMP, but we are not yet FedRAMP‑authorized. We need someone who is scrappy, creative, and comfortable selling ahead of certifications — designing viable paths to value and deployment in a pre‑FedRAMP world while influencing our longer‑term public sector strategy.
